About Frank Patrick

Frank Patrick Nardi practices bankruptcy law in Totowa, New Jersey. He has been a prominent figure in the legal community since earning his J.D. from New York Law School in 1995. His firm focuses on various legal matters, including business law, estate planning, real estate law, and tax law. Nardi's experience allows him to navigate complex financial situations for his clients. He began his career after obtaining a B.S.

in Accounting from Rutgers University in 1989. This educational background has been instrumental in his approach to bankruptcy cases. His dual expertise in law and accounting enables him to provide comprehensive advice to individuals and businesses facing financial difficulties. Nardi understands the details of both legal and financial systems, which is crucial in bankruptcy proceedings. Most of Nardi's work involves representing clients in Chapter 7 and Chapter 13 bankruptcy filings. He assists clients through the entire process—from initial consultations to court appearances.

His knowledge of tax law also plays a significant role in his practice, as many clients face tax-related issues during bankruptcy. Cases typically involve negotiations with creditors, asset protection strategies, and financial restructuring. Before establishing his own practice, Nardi worked working in various legal settings.
